Transaction ef71a6165d1f332a28a76efa5a08f8f6c5e81999a01b944ffbaa6523e1a31869
1 Input
1 Output
-
ef71a6165d1f332a28a76efa5a08f8f6c5e81999a01b944ffbaa6523e1a31869:0
- value
- 9655
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4186e542e7cffdcd48d4e285fe9c2119b9df988
- address
- bc1q6svxu4pw0nlae4ydfc59l6wzzxdem7vg8rum3c